Taxidermy: A Journey from Nature to Display

Taxidermy, the captivating art of preserving animal remains, has intrigued humans for centuries. It's a meticulous process that transforms once-living creatures into permanent exhibits. The journey from field to frame is a true art form, requiring both skillful artistry.

Taxidermists begin by procuring ethically sourced remains. Once the animal is obtained, they here meticulously dissect the skin and bones, ensuring preservation against decomposition.

Subsequently, the skin is tanned and stretched over a mannequin, achieving stunning realism. Adding details like eyes, teeth, and feathers completes the transformation.

Finally, the taxidermied animal finds a home in private collections, serving as a reminder of nature's beauty.
